Transaction 3b1e8e26f5d04bf153a228c377179d2e890cb2c0fa63e82c319829f9c9dcd551

block
454d19065d26d9423dd3528cfcecccc595016381c698fbcc1ef3dc07502e54ea

1 Input

23 Outputs